> While running the script I observed no stack trace but sysfs hang for a > particular file like scaling_governor under cpufreq for a particular cpu > (this cpu is varying). In the following run I experienced with cpu4. > > cat /sys/devices/system/cpu/cpu4/cpufreq/scaling_governor > > The above command is not giving any result and it won't be coming out > after pressing ctrl+c or ctrl+z
Applied both the patches and it seems working fine - no stack trace, but the above "mentioned circular locking dependency and sysfs file hang" are existing.
